DESCRIPTION:Childhood obesity is a growing concern world-wide. This semina
 r will outline\nthe ongoing inter-disciplinary work on childhood and obesi
 ty being carried\nout by the International Centre for Research in Children
 's Literature\,\nLiteracy and Creativity at the University of Worcester. C
 onsideration will\nalso be given to differing cultural attitudes towards o
 besity and the\nconstruction of the overweight child in literature and the
  media since the\nnineteenth century. \n\nJean Webb is Professor of Intern
 ational Children's Literature at the\nUniversity of Worcester. She is Dire
 ctor of the International Centre for\nResearch in Children's Literature\, 
 Literacy and Creativity.\n
